Wimpod
This Pokémon is a coward. As it desperately dashes off, the flailing of its many legs leaves a sparkling clean path in its wake.
| Supertype | Pokémon |
|---|---|
| Subtype | Basic |
| HP | 70 |
| Types | Grass |
| Attack | Scamper Away |
| Attack cost | Colorless |
| Artist | match |
| Rarity | Common |
| Pokédex | 767 |
| Evolves to | Golisopod |
